Performance Data

1

Influent challenge levels are average influent concentrations determined in surrogate qualification testing.

2

Environmental Protection Agency Maximum Contaminant Level, as required under the Safe Drinking Water Act.

3

Micrograms per Liter, which is equivalent to parts per billion (PPB).

4

Maximum product water level was not observed, but was set at the detection limit of analysis.

5

Maximum product water level is set at a value determined in surrogate qualification testing.

6

Chemical reduction percent and maximum product water level calculated at chloroform 95% breakthrough point, as determined in sur-

rogate qualification testing.

7

The surrogate test results for Heptachlor Epoxide demonstrated a 98% reduction.  These data were used to calculate an upper occur-

rence concentration, which would produce a maximum product water level at the MCL.
